Three things CMS can do now to position accountable quality reporting for the future
As leaders move health care quality programs toward a technology-enabled future, accountable care organizations (ACOs) can play an integral role in piloting new initiatives, such as digital quality measures (dQMs), and evaluating the feasibility of approaches. However, the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) must reassess the current approach for Clinical Quality Measures (CQMs) that align Medicare Shared Savings Program (MSSP) quality measures and reporting to the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S). This inaccurate comparison unfairly burdens providers and impedes progress towards population health.
